Valentine’s Day Special: Swoon-Worthy Quotes

In honor of Valentine’s Day, we’ve  decided to add to a list of heart-melting quotes from some of our dearest literary crushes. We got the idea from our friends at YA Crush, who highlighted five of our all-time favorites: Will from “Clockwork Prince”; Adam from “If I Stay”/”Where She Went”; Akiva from “Daughter of Smoke and Bone”; Cricket from “Lola and the Boy Next Door”; and Finnikin from “Finnikin of the Rock.” Tee and Vee are clearly our kindred spirits, so we’re taking their first five lovelies and adding several of our own! Happy Valentine’s Day, fellow YA lovers.
